/**
* returns a hash_table of all the soap_header_block_t struct in this
* soap_header_t object that have the the specified actor. An
* actor is a global attribute that indicates the intermediate parties to
* whom the message should be sent. An actor receives the message and then
* sends it to the next actor. The default actor is the ultimate intended
* recipient for the message, so if no actor attribute is set in a
* axiom_soap_header_t struct the message is sent to its ultimate
* destination.
* @param header pointer to soap_header struct
* @param env Environment. MUST NOT be NULL
* @param role the role value for the examination
*
* @return hash_table of all the soap_header_block_t struct
*/
AXIS2_EXTERN axutil_hash_t *AXIS2_CALL
axiom_soap_header_examine_header_blocks(
axiom_soap_header_t * header,
const axutil_env_t * env,
axis2_char_t * param_role);
